Girona take on Cadiz at Estadi Montilivi in La Liga on Saturday (20:00) with both teams having plenty to play for in the final weeks of the season. The hosts are still fighting to secure a spot in next season's Champions League, while Cadiz are fighting for top-flight survival.

Both sides' form has been up and down in recent weeks, with the two teams having won two of their last five. But I'm expecting an interesting battle here, as detailed in my Girona vs Cadiz predictions.

Team News

Joel Roca will be missing for Girona due to a long-term injury, while duo Viktor Tsyhankov and Ricard Artero are also in the treatment room. Ivan Martin will return to the fold, however, after serving his suspension in the defeat against Atletico Madrid last time out.

For the visitors, Jose Mari, Romingue Kouame, Luis Hernandez and Fede San Emeterio will all be unavailable for selection on Saturday due to injury. They will also be unavailable to call upon Javi Hernandez as he will serve a suspension for picking up too many yellow cards.
